About Blue Hole Wimberley

Blue Hole Wimberley is a stunning cold spring nestled in the heart of Texas, known for its crystal-clear, blue-green waters and serene natural setting. Flowing beneath towering cypress trees, this resort-style swimming hole offers a refreshing escape framed by lush shade and a lively rope swing, inviting you to relax and connect with nature.

Getting There

Located just a short drive from San Antonio, you can reach Blue Hole Wimberley via I-35 to San Marcos, then Ranch Road 12 northwest to Wimberley. From there, follow Deer Lake Road straight to the city park entrance, where ample parking is available. No hiking is needed—drive up and step right into the inviting waters.

What to Expect

You’ll find cool, clear water flowing through a naturally beautiful, shaded basin perfect for swimming and soaking. The atmosphere is peaceful yet vibrant, often drawing families and locals to enjoy its multi-generational charm. Facilities are maintained through the city park, though the fee policy for swimming is subject to change, so check ahead.

Tips for Visitors

Visit year-round to enjoy the spring’s consistent temperature and scenic beauty. Bring water shoes for the rocky bottom and sunscreen for time spent outside the shaded areas. Since fees are uncertain, pack some cash just in case, and respect park rules to help preserve this beloved Texas swimming hole.
